We used to have the ability to sort tracks in an album by title, length, popularity, and of course track number, at least in the web app. This is no longer possible in the web app, and it’s also not possible in the macOS or Android apps. Now the only way to sort tracks is to add them to a playlist first. This is quite a decrease in functionality. Restoring it would be a good way for Deezer to distinguish itself from Apple Music, Spotify, etc., which don’t have the capability. So please restore the ability to sort tracks in an album by title, track number, length, and popularity.By the way, there’s another suggestion like this by @jacob1122 here, but @Yula mistakenly moved the votes to a different suggestion pertaining to playlists, which as far as I can tell, already have the sort ability. This idea is about tracks in albums, not playlists.
